Real Estate Funding – Most important. What to do?

Ray Cummins
  • Investor
  • Holly Springs NC
Posted

Hello BP Forums.

I have multiple ways I could finance my next Real Estate Investment. Looking to invest in the Fayetteville NC area.

Question? What order would you rank the following? Which of these would be your priority?

1. 401K loan

2. Cash out Refi of rental properties

3. HELOC on primary house

4. HELOC on 2 rental properties

5. Self-Directed IRA

6. Use Credit Cards

7. Portfolio Lender

Let me know what you think and why. Add more if you would like.
